Drug-likeness

Descriptor-based ADME screening flags from SMILES. These are not experimental toxicity results.

Permeability proxy High

Estimated from TPSA and LogP only: TPSA ≤ 90 Ų and −1 ≤ LogP ≤ 5 are treated as a favorable small-molecule permeability screen.

  • TPSA ≤ 90 Ų 73.4
  • −1 ≤ LogP ≤ 5 4.34
Lipinski's Rule of Five Pass 0 violations
  • MW ≤ 500 Da 370.8
  • LogP ≤ 5 4.34
  • H-bond donors ≤ 5 2
  • H-bond acceptors ≤ 10 2
Veber's rules Pass
  • Rotatable bonds ≤ 10 4
  • TPSA ≤ 140 Ų 73.4
PAINS Alert

Matches PAINS filter: indol_3yl_alk(461). May be a frequent false positive in HTS — review carefully.
